Job Summary
Provide direct ABA therapy to children with autism spectrum disorder (ASD) in center-based and group settings under supervision. Implement individualized treatment plans developed by a BCBA, teach communication, social, daily living, play, and adaptive skills, and collect accurate session data using an iPad. Collaborate with families and an interdisciplinary team to support learner goals, participate in trainings and supervision, maintain HIPAA compliance, and uphold safety protocols in a fast-paced clinical environment.
